Transforming Education with AI: A Legislative Initiative

As educational technologies evolve rapidly, Illinois lawmakers are stepping up to address the crucial issue of integrating artificial intelligence (AI) in classrooms. Recognizing the potential impact of AI tools in enhancing learning outcomes, the state is considering a proposal aimed at establishing comprehensive guidelines to govern their use in educational settings. The initiative, backed by educators and advocacy groups, hopes to provide a structured framework that ensures AI applications are deployed responsibly and ethically.



The proposal comes amidst vibrant discussions about the role of AI in shaping education today. The introduction of two bills, HB2503 and SB1556, in the Illinois House and Senate marks a significant step toward formalizing AI's role in classrooms. These bills advocate for the creation of an advisory committee tasked with developing and distributing essential guidance for school districts, ensuring that educators and institutions utilize AI tools effectively.



The urgency of this initiative stems from the accelerating integration of various AI applications in educational environments. From automated grading systems to personalized learning platforms, AI has the potential to revolutionize the way students learn and interact with academic content. However, with great power comes great responsibility, leading to apprehensions concerning data protection and academic integrity. Illinois lawmakers are taking a proactive stance to ensure that the introduction of AI into classrooms is accompanied by thoughtful considerations about how these technologies should be utilized.



Bill Provisions and Stakeholder Perspectives

The proposed legislation mandates that school districts include detailed information regarding AI usage in their annual reports submitted to the Illinois State Board of Education. This transparency is designed not only to keep parents and guardians informed but also to allow for a thorough evaluation of how AI tools impact student learning and engagement. The bills have already garnered support from influential organizations like Teach Plus Illinois, which has been instrumental in shaping recommendations aimed at optimizing AI's role in the classroom.



Educators are increasingly vocal about the need for established guidelines surrounding AI because they recognize that the technologies available can significantly enhance student engagement, provide personalized learning pathways, and offer immediate feedback. Joe Brewer, a Teach Plus fellow and a seasoned educator, has actively shared his experiences with AI tools in his classroom. He advocates for AI's role in fostering a dynamic learning environment while emphasizing the necessity of adequate training for teachers to navigate these technologies responsibly.



Despite the enthusiasm surrounding AI in education, Brewer and other educators have raised concerns about potential misuse and the broader implications of AI integration. The call for institutional awareness underscores the need for education around data privacy issues, ensuring that students’ information is safeguarded against misuse. By establishing clear guidelines and requiring transparency around AI usage, Illinois lawmakers aim to create a responsible framework for employing these cutting-edge technologies in schools.

Navigating Challenges and Opportunities in AI Integration

While the proposal for AI guidelines in Illinois classrooms has gained significant support, it also faces challenges that need to be addressed. The multifaceted nature of education means that integrating AI technologies will not be a one-size-fits-all solution. Different school districts may have varying levels of access to technology and resources, leading to potential disparities in AI's application across the state.



Ensuring equitable access to AI tools and resources is crucial for maximizing their benefits. Lawmakers and educational leaders must consider the unique needs of each district when formulating guidelines. Providing training opportunities for educators across diverse settings is essential to equip them with the knowledge and skills necessary to effectively leverage AI in the classroom.



One significant opportunity presented by AI is its ability to enhance personalized learning experiences. With the right guidance and frameworks, AI can analyze individual student performance data and provide custom-tailored educational resources. This personalized approach can foster engagement and motivate students who might otherwise fall behind in a traditional learning environment.



However, it is imperative to remain vigilant regarding potential pitfalls. Issues surrounding ethical AI usage in classrooms need to be forefront in discussions, as the risk of bias in algorithms could inadvertently disadvantage certain groups of students. This emphasizes the importance of continuous monitoring and assessment of AI tools by educators and policymakers alike. The establishment of a regulatory framework through the proposed legislation can help set standards for ethical AI practices in education.
